- Learning SessionsMar 14, 2025 · 6 months agoThe margin interest rate offered by Fidelity can have a significant impact on cryptocurrency trading. When the interest rate is low, it becomes more attractive for traders to borrow funds and engage in leveraged trading. This can lead to increased trading volume and potentially higher price volatility in the cryptocurrency market. On the other hand, high margin interest rates may discourage traders from borrowing and trading on margin, which could result in lower trading activity and reduced market liquidity. Additionally, higher interest rates can increase the cost of holding leveraged positions, potentially reducing the profitability of such trades.
- Cancy KhandelwalMar 06, 2024 · 2 years agoMargin interest rates play a crucial role in determining the risk-reward profile of cryptocurrency trading. When the interest rate is low, traders can take advantage of leverage to amplify their potential profits. However, this also increases the risk of losses, as leverage magnifies both gains and losses. On the other hand, high margin interest rates can act as a deterrent for traders who are risk-averse or have limited capital. They may prefer to avoid borrowing and trading on margin to minimize their exposure to interest costs. Therefore, the impact of fidelity margin interest rates on cryptocurrency trading depends on the risk appetite and trading strategies of individual traders.
